Howard Schnellenberger stands at the helm of the University of Miami football program in the 1980s, a time of significant cultural change in Miami, Florida. Under his leadership, the Hurricanes recruit players from challenging backgrounds, reshaping the team's identity and challenging the university's image. The documentary details the rise of the Hurricanes, who claim four national championships between 1983 and 1991. Directed by Billy Corben, the film captures how the team became known as the 'Bad Boys' of college football, reflecting the vibrant hip hop culture of the era.

Did You Know
- The U premiered on December 12, 2009, drawing 2.3 million viewers.
- The DVD cover was altered to remove the 'U' logo after university objections.
- The sequel, The U Part 2, was released in December 2014.

Frequently Asked Questions
When did The U premiere?
The U premiered on December 12, 2009.
Who directed The U?
The U was directed by Billy Corben.
What was the viewership for The U's premiere?
The premiere drew 2.3 million viewers, the most ever for a documentary on ESPN until the debut of Pony Excess.
